Priced affordably at approximately $50, the Anker SoundCore 2 is a Bluetooth speaker that can significantly enhance your phone audio without draining your wallet.

Its astounding battery life, lasting up to 24 hours, and its sturdy, water-resistant structure are top features.

Although it may not deliver audio performance on par with the highest-end waterproof speakers, the cost-effectiveness of the SoundCore 2 is undeniable, particularly if you’re keen on more budget-friendly options.

In terms of aesthetics, the SoundCore 2 might not be sweeping any design awards. It’s a nondescript black bar with a series of control buttons—power, play/pause, pairing, and volume—on its top surface.

Two 6-watt drivers are hidden behind a black metal grille on the front of the speaker, while on the side you’ll find a water-resistant covering that safeguards the micro USB charging port and a 3.5mm auxiliary port, handy for interfacing with older gadgets.

The speaker’s casing is clad in a matte black rubber material that is pleasing to the touch but prone to fingerprint smudging. The durability of the speaker’s construction is admirable, and its rough-and-tumble body and splash-proof design can bear the rigors of outdoor use.

Remember, though, that its water resistance is rated at IPX5, meaning it can handle light splashes but isn’t designed for full submersion like the UE Wonderboom.

The Anker SoundCore 2’s compact dimensions of 165mm x 54mm x 45mm make it conveniently portable, and easy to slip into a bag without concern about damage or excessive bulk. The rectangular shape contributes to its portability, and it’s lightweight enough for effortless travel.

When it comes to audio quality, the SoundCore 2 is fair, offering a significant improvement over any standard smartphone speaker. While the overall audio balance is decent, the bass response can be lacking, especially in genres like electronic dance music and hip-hop.

High-frequency sounds are acceptable but may distort when the volume is cranked up.

The volume output of the SoundCore 2 could be higher to satisfy some listeners. Although it’s sufficiently loud in a tranquil room, it may struggle to be heard over background noise.

In a volume and distortion comparison with the UE Wonderboom, the latter certainly outperformed the SoundCore 2.

An ideal companion for a variety of gatherings, from house to pool to beach parties, the JBL Boombox 3 is a robust speaker that offers durability with an IP67 rating and impressive sound quality. However, it leans toward the expensive side considering its features.

As the latest entrant in JBL’s lineup of Bluetooth speakers, the JBL Boombox 3 succeeds the JBL Boombox 2.

Its loud sound and water-resistant qualities, along with an IP67 rating, make it an excellent option for parties. But does it justify the hefty price tag, and does it meet the expectations set by its predecessor?

The JBL Boombox 3 is a sizable portable Bluetooth speaker equipped with a handle for easy portability. It tips the scales at 6.7kg, which can be hefty to carry around.

Available in two color options – black and camouflage, it aligns with the current trend of JBL speakers that are rated IP67 for resistance to water and dust.

This allows the speaker to endure being underwater up to one meter for a duration of 30 minutes and it’s entirely resistant to dust. These features make it the perfect speaker to bring along to the beach or a picnic, and cleaning it is as simple as rinsing it off.

The speaker is configured with one subwoofer, a pair of midrange drivers, and two tweeters, all facing forward. The dual passive radiators on the sides of the Boombox 3 create vibrations that can be felt when playing music with heavy bass.

For connectivity, the Boombox 3 leverages Bluetooth 5.3 and supports the SBC codec. The back of the speaker hosts a 3.5mm port for a wired connection with your phone, alongside a USB-A port for phone charging.

For an uninterrupted power supply, it can be plugged directly into a wall socket. As per JBL’s claim, the Boombox 3 has a wireless operation time of 24 hours and takes about 6 hours and 30 minutes to recharge fully.

There’s also an accompanying app for the speaker – the JBL Portable app, available on iOS and Android. The app allows for software updates, EQ adjustments, and speaker connections via PartyBoost mode.

In terms of audio performance, the JBL Boombox 3 shines with clear, loud output. The sound doesn’t deteriorate even when the volume is cranked up, making it a suitable option for parties.

The speaker tends to favor bass, which may be a bonus or a minus depending on individual preferences. However, the JBL Portable app’s equalizer feature allows for toning down or amplifying the bass as per your liking.

The Ultimate Ears Wonderboom 3 is an impressive portable Bluetooth speaker, ideal for parties or travel. Its compact, durable design and lightweight structure make it easy to carry in a backpack. However, the absence of USB-C charging could be viewed as a minor setback.

Gone are the days when blasting music through smartphone speakers at a gathering was considered passable. The audio quality was inevitably poor, often leading to grating, highly distorted sound.

Thankfully, Bluetooth speakers have evolved significantly, offering high-quality sound from compact devices that can fit in a purse or a backpack.

The Ultimate Ears Wonderboom 3 exemplifies this trend, providing excellent sound for house parties or adventurous camping trips. But does it have any shortcomings?

The Ultimate Ears Wonderboom 3 is a portable Bluetooth speaker designed for mobility and user-friendly operation. It houses two active drivers and two passive radiators that contribute to a comprehensive sound output.

Its IP67 rating implies it’s dust-resistant and can withstand being submerged in a meter of water, making it ideal for outdoor use. To enhance the sound outdoors, there’s an “Outdoors Boost” button that modifies the audio quality accordingly.

Bluetooth is the primary means of audio reception for the speaker, and there’s no provision for a wired connection. For a stereo sound experience, it can be paired with another Wonderboom 3 unit.

The speaker also supports Bluetooth multipoint, allowing simultaneous connectivity with up to two devices. Its controls are all physical buttons, each corresponding to a particular feature, and it charges via a Micro-USB port.

The audio quality of the Wonderboom 3 is commendable. Despite its small size, it delivers a loud sound with an even frequency response, avoiding any excessive emphasis on specific frequencies.

While it doesn’t match the bass power of larger speakers or a setup with a dedicated subwoofer, it still holds its own.

The Outdoor Boost button, located at the bottom of the speaker, tweaks the sound to adapt to outdoor environments, considering there are no walls or corners for sound to bounce off—quite a clever feature.

For those who enjoy using the Ultimate Ears Wonderboom 3 outdoors, the IP67 rating—signifying water resistance for up to thirty minutes of submersion and dust resistance—will be appreciated.

The company also claims the speaker can survive drops from heights up to five feet. Although we wouldn’t recommend testing this, the overall impression is that the Wonderboom 3 is a well-constructed and robust unit.

The UE Megaboom 3 is a solid contender if you’re in the market for a speaker upgrade or replacement. It builds upon the exceptional features of its predecessor, the Megaboom, offering improved sound, battery longevity, and durability, all at a lower price point.

It’s not just one of the top-ranking waterproof speakers; it’s a leader among Bluetooth speakers in general. Let’s delve into our UE Megaboom 3 review to understand why.

The Megaboom 3, measuring 8.9 x 3.4 inches and weighing 2 pounds, streamlines the cylindrical look of its earlier version, enhancing several design elements.

The volume buttons, previously sticking out, are now seamlessly integrated into the mesh exterior, and the charging port is conveniently relocated from the bottom to the side.

On the top of the speaker, you’ll find a power button, a Bluetooth pairing button, and a central feature called the Magic Button.

The Magic Button can be configured to initiate playlists on Apple Music or Deezer. However, its core function lies in controlling playback. A single press pauses or plays the current track, and a double tap progresses to the next song.

This feature replaces the previous model’s touch-sensitive top and offers more consistent operation.

The Megaboom 3 omits the auxiliary input, meaning a wired connection isn’t possible, a feature removed during the redesign. The speakerphone function was also eliminated in this new model.

Audio-wise, the Megaboom 3 provides a well-balanced output of bass, mids, and trebles. It has a slightly elevated bass compared to the original Megaboom and a more robust overall sound than the Fugoo Style-S, handling various music genres with aplomb.

When it comes to volume, the Megaboom 3 truly shines. Its sound can reach nearly 100 decibels at maximum volume, although some distortion may occur at this level.

The IPX67 rating on the Megaboom 3 ensures it’s waterproof up to 3 feet of water for 30 minutes. During testing, the speaker was submerged in a sink full of water for 5 minutes, and its performance remained unaffected.

The speaker’s battery life is impressive, with UE claiming it can last up to 20 hours on a full charge—a likely understatement. After approximately 10 hours of usage at low to moderate volumes, the Megaboom 3 had 77% of its battery remaining.

Pairing the Megaboom 3 with an iPhone was quick and efficient, and the speaker demonstrated strong signal strength, even through multiple indoor walls.

The latest Boom and Megaboom app (available for iOS and Android) introduces several practical features but also removes a few. It allows pairing the Megaboom 3 with older models and other UE speakers, such as the Boom 2 and Boom 3.

The Magic Button can be assigned to specific playlists, with a 3-second press initiating playback. Preset equalizer settings can be selected, or custom ones can be created. However, the new app lacks an alarm feature and doesn’t support Siri or Google Assistant via the speaker.

The Sonos Move makes its mark as a versatile yet sophisticated addition to the brand’s lineup, catering to the niche of listeners who desire a portable home audio solution.

Despite being Sonos’ debut attempt at a Bluetooth speaker, its performance and design merit serious consideration. Yet, is this transition from home-based to mobile audio a successful venture for Sonos?

Known primarily for their stylish and user-friendly home audio systems, Sonos doesn’t have a reputation for ruggedness.

However, with the Move, Sonos significantly ramps up its robustness, boasting an IP56 weatherproof rating and purported shockproof capabilities.

Although we didn’t deliberately subject it to harsh tests, it survived a three-foot fall from a bedside table unscathed. Still, the soft plastic finish may not withstand a fall on harder surfaces without getting scuffed.

The Sonos Move, despite its name, tends not to stray far from its charging bracket. In this mode, it primarily functions as a smart speaker, always ready for duty, given its constant state of charge.

This charging cradle integration is a commendable feature that we’d love to see in more Bluetooth speakers. Moreover, the Move can also be charged via any USB-C charger, adding a layer of convenience.

Although the Sonos Move offers portability, its heft (around 3kg) and the awkwardly shaped built-in handle make it less suitable for longer distances or more adventurous outings.

If your lifestyle demands a lighter, more travel-friendly companion, consider options like the JBL Flip 6 or the UE BOOM 3.

However, if you need a quality speaker for indoor use that can also accommodate occasional outdoor use, the Sonos Move is a viable candidate. Its ability to transition smoothly from a living room centerpiece to a backyard entertainer might make it the ideal choice for some.

Valued at $199.99, the Sony SRS-XE300 takes its place as the intermediate member of Sony’s newest X series of Bluetooth speakers, flanked by the SRS-XE200 and SRS-XG300.

It surprises with its robust volume, given its compact form factor, and scores points with its rugged design. The additional app, offering an assortment of EQ and battery optimization options, brings a certain charm.

However, Sony’s unconventional approach to driver configuration does not seem to deliver on its promise of superior sound spread. If the unique design had noticeably improved performance, the higher price tag could be justified, but it falls short in this respect.

Therefore, at $179.99, the JBL Charge 5 continues to be our preferred choice in this price segment, its traditional driver arrangement delivering a sound experience that is more reliable.

With a weight of 2.9 pounds, the SRS-XE300 comes in shades of black, gray, and teal. Its form resembles an elongated, curved pentagon and measures 9.4 by 4.1 by 4.7 inches (HWD).

It allows for both vertical and horizontal placements, though most promotional images from Sony depict it in a vertical stance.

At first glance, the source of the sound isn’t easily discernible because Sony employs a line-shaped diffuser for this device. The vertically aligned drivers are broader than what the slim line of fabric-covered grilles may imply.

Sound is projected through a slender slit instead of a freely exposed cover. A majority of the device is clad in sturdy silicone, leaving only a vertical control strip on the right side exposed.

Beneath the grille, two 1.9-by-2.8-inch full-range drivers are stacked vertically. The oval layout, affording more area on the speaker cone, is expected to generate higher sound pressure and limit driver movement.

Sony’s claim is that this design choice should result in stronger bass, diminished distortion, and an expanded soundstage. There are passive radiators at both ends; however, one is located at the bottom when the speaker is placed vertically.

Although the radiators can project sound in a forward or upward direction, we recommend starting with a horizontal placement to prevent any radiator from facing blockages. Interestingly, the default sound output from this speaker is mono, but the stereo output can be enabled through the app.

This device is compatible with Bluetooth 5.2 and supports the AAC, SBC, and LDAC codecs, but AptX is not supported. The provision of LDAC support opens up the possibility of high-resolution streaming for Android users. In the app, this model can be paired with other models from the X series for a synchronized multi-speaker configuration. For Android users, Google Fast Pair is another handy feature.

The control strip houses buttons for power, Bluetooth, multifunction (which handles playback, track navigation, and call features based on the frequency of pressing), volume, battery (which verbally informs about the remaining battery life), and a mute/unmute feature for the microphone.

The buttons are user-friendly, but a slight lag was observed between pressing a button and receiving auditory confirmation. An LED nestled between the power and Bluetooth buttons signifies when the speaker is powered or charging.

An additional light beneath the battery button illuminates when the Stamina mode is activated, which will be discussed further later.

Looking for a discreet speaker option for your backyard that can withstand outdoor conditions? The Pohopa EF-B210G might be the solution.

These sleek speakers are sold in pairs and are designed to resemble lanterns, blending seamlessly with your landscaping. Equipped with built-in LED lights, they not only provide audio but also serve as outdoor lighting fixtures.

Thanks to Bluetooth connectivity, you can easily stream music from your phone, and enjoy over 60 hours of uninterrupted playback. Additionally, these speakers have an IP54 rating, ensuring resistance to dust and water exposure.

It’s important to note, however, that like many outdoor decorative speakers we’ve tested, the focus of the Pohopa EF-B210G is more on design than sound quality.

While they are more than suitable for casual listening sessions, discerning audiophiles may detect a slightly muddier and less defined sound compared to premium alternatives like the Ultimate Ears MEGABOOM 3.

Furthermore, without any customization options, you won’t be able to fine-tune their performance.

That being said, if audio fidelity is not your top priority, these speakers are still an excellent choice, delivering ample volume for your music or podcasts. In summary, they rank among the top wireless outdoor speakers we’ve tested.

This party speaker weighs approximately 5.5 kilograms and exudes a sturdy feel with its robust handle. It beckons you to carry it on your shoulder, reminiscent of the iconic ghetto blasters from the last century.

Equipped with Bluetooth 5.3, this speaker not only promises significantly clearer sound compared to the cassette tapes of classic models, but it also boasts an eye-catching light show featuring 32 LEDs that flicker to the beat of the music.

By pressing the light symbol on the impeccably designed and labeled keypad, as is customary for Tribit, you can conserve energy, although it’s worth noting that energy consumption is not a pressing concern in this case.

However, it serves as an effective means to extend the battery life for park gatherings or beach parties.

While achieving the full promised 30 hours of battery life with the light shows may be unrealistic, if a power outlet is accessible at the party location, there are no inhibitions to turning up the light and sound levels.

Tribit provides a reasonably priced Bluetooth speaker with a standard power supply unit, which conveniently charges the 2200 mAh battery in under four hours.

The front panel of the Tribit Stormbox Blast features two wedge-shaped LED bars surrounding two 3cm tweeters and two 11cm bass-midrange drivers.

These components are driven by either 2 x 15 or 2 x 30 watts, resulting in a total power output of 90 watts. The two outer tweeters on either end of the front panel support the vibrant light bars with their illuminated membranes, producing captivating light organ effects.

Square passive bass radiators on each side of the speaker cabinet further enhance the low-frequency performance. For those craving even more powerful bass, the XBass button provides an additional boost.

To ensure that beach parties with the Tribit Stormbox Blast leave no lasting traces, the speaker boasts an impressive IPX7 water resistance rating, allowing it to be submerged up to one meter.

The ports on the back are protected from splashes and dirt by a rubber flap. Additionally, the Tribit Stormbox Blast offers versatility in connectivity, featuring a USB-A port that allows it to function as a power bank, supplying power to smart devices while simultaneously playing music via Bluetooth or the analog 3.5 mm AUX jack input.

With its comprehensive connectivity options, this Bluetooth speaker is well-equipped for various scenarios.
